Fox 0-2 inches Front 0-1 inches Rear Lift Shocks for Nissan Xterra 05-13
Part Number: 6a1887b4d048
Summary: This FOX 2.0 Performance Series shock package is engineered to provide a direct replacement solution for the Nissan Xterra. Featuring Internal Floating Piston (IFP) technology, these shocks are designed to separate oil from the high-pressure nitrogen gas to prevent aeration. The aluminum body construction ensures faster heat dissipation compared to traditional steel, maintaining consistent damping performance during both on-road and off-road use.

Technical Specifications
| Specification | Value |
|---|---|
| Series | 2.0 Performance Series Coil-over IFP (Front) / 2.0 Performance Series IFP (Rear) |
| Position | Front and Rear |
| Front Extended Length | 16.857 Inch |
| Front Collapsed Length | 12.532 Inch |
| Front Travel | 4.324 Inch |
| Rear Extended Length | 20.45 Inch |
| Rear Collapsed Length | 13.35 Inch |
| Rear Travel | 7.1 Inch |
| Lower Mount | Eyelet |
| Notes | Front: 0-2 inches Lift; Rear: 0-1 inches Lift |
Fitment
- 2005-2013 Nissan Xterra
- Note: Configured for 0-2 inches front lift and 0-1 inches rear lift.
What’s Included
- Includes 4 Shocks
- (2) 983-02-054 Front Coil-over IFP Shocks
- (2) 985-24-034 Rear IFP Shocks

do these lift my xterra without a lift kit? I want 2 inches of lift and ride quality is a top priority.
-
0 votesQ do these lift my xterra without a lift kit? I want 2 inches of lift and ride quality is a top pri...... Read moreA FOX shocks will give you excellent ride quality. Front coilovers are adjustable - can give you up to 2'' of front lift. Rear shocks will not lift the rear end by themselves - they are just longer then stock - they can be used either for stock rear height or for 1-2'' of rear lift.
